I've seen guys bore out lower/upper triple trees from 39 mm forks to fit 41 mm fork tubes. It's a safe mod, but if you want to go really narrow with 41 mm fork tubes, then go with Mullins Chain Drive triple trees. Personally, I prefer a "mid-Glide" width fork, so a front brake can be installed. I'm digging the build here. Keep the toolbox. Thanks, STL Nik.
@@eugi7040 I'd check to see if Custom Cycle Engineering is still in business. Years ago, CCI offered mid-glide trees made out of aircraft-grade aluminum. They were not cheap, but they were a quality item made in the USA. Maybe -- just maybe, Mullins Chain Drive might start fabbing mid-glide fork triple clamps. I'm always in favor of running a front brake. Hopefully, this helps.
